Life Is a Spiral not a Straight Line


Most people live their lives from within a limited framework.
They first of all have a life that is defined by space and time.
People believe time and space to be linear in nature.
They understand their lives in terms of a beginning and an ending.
People usually see themselves and their life as somewhere along a line somewhere between the beginning and the end.
When young they are nearer the beginning and when they are old the nearer the end. We begin with birth and end with death.
This perception of time leads us to see our life as a succession of events. Our life becomes a series of occurrences that we anticipate in the future, which then come to us in the present, finally to recede into the past. We see our life as a timeline.
The reality is that straight lines only exist from a limited point of view. We must not mistake the map for the reality.
The truth is that the earth we live on is spherical. It circles the sun. We cannot in reality draw a straight line. It only looks like a straight line as we view it from our perspective standing on the earth. All lines must in reality be part of a circular motion.
So, a line only looks straight when view from a limited perspective. In fact, the buildings that we work so hard to make strong and straight are part of the arc of the circle of the earth's surface.
The truth is that the whole natural movement of the universe is spiralic. The fundamental movement of the earth is that of a moving circle or a spiral. The moon circles the earth, the earth circles the sun, the sun circles in a spiralling galaxy.
Our cosmic, unlimited and divine consciousness can only emerge when we experience the spiralic movement of the universe. As long as we are locked into a linear perspective, our universe will be limited.
Linearity is a function of limitation. There is no such thing as a never ending straight line. The spiral functions into infinity. 
We are forever beings and our life as many beginnings and many endings as we spiral through the multi-universe of the Now. Our life is truly marvellous when we break out of the shackles of a linear universe.
